Aloe Vera Barbadensis

The use of Aloe in beauty & healing has been recorded throughout millennia & continues to deliver consistent therapeutic results, which have now been verified in many scientific studies(8).

Aloe is a vegan source of hyaluronic acid which draws moisture into the skin, alleviating dryness and signs of aging(9). Aloe stimulates cell growth and provides a myriad of necessary amino acids and nutrients that are essential for healthy, vibrant skin(8).
